• 欢迎访问搞代码网站,推荐使用最新版火狐浏览器和Chrome浏览器访问本网站!
  • 如果您觉得本站非常有看点,那么赶紧使用Ctrl+D 收藏搞代码吧

zabbix 监控php-fpm 性能

php 搞代码 4年前 (2022-01-23) 20次浏览 已收录 0个评论

首先需要开启php-fpm状态功能

http://www.ttlsa.com/php/use-php-fpm-status-page-detail/

http://www.ttlsa.com/zabbix/zabbix-monitor-php-fpm-status/

vim /usr/local/php/etc/php-fpm.conf

pm.status_path = /status 去掉注释

vim /etc/nginx/vhost/web.conf

server

{

listen 80;

server_name 192.168.80.62;

index index.php index.html index.htm default.html default.htm default.php;

root /usr/local/nginx/html;

location ~ .*\.(php|php5)?$

{

fastcgi_pass 127.0.0.1:9000;

fastcgi_index index.php;

include /etc/nginx/fastcgi_params;

}

location ~ ^/(status|ping)$ #加上红色部分

{

include fastcgi_params;

fastcgi_pass 127.0.0.1:9000;

fastcgi_param SCRIPT_FILENAME $fastcgi_script_name;

}

location /ngx_status {

stub_status on;

access_log off;

}

location ~ .*\.(gif|jpg|jpeg|png|bmp|swf)$

{

expires 30d;

}

location ~ .*\.(js|css)?$

{

expires 12h;

}

access_log off;

}

重启php-fpm

pkill php-fpm

/usr/local/php/sbin/php-fpm

测试如下ok

[root@zabbixserver ~]# curl http://127.0.0.1/status

pool: www

process manager: dynamic

start time: 18/May/2016:07:04+本文来源gao@daima#com搞(%代@#码网

搞代gaodaima码

:35 +0800

start since: 715765

accepted conn: 21386

listen queue: 0

max listen queue: 1

listen queue len: 128

idle processes: 5

active processes: 1

total processes: 6

max active processes: 6

max children reached: 0

slow requests: 0

zabbix客户端配置key

vim /usr/local/zabbix/etc/zabbix_agentd.conf

UserParameter=php-fpm.status[*],/usr/bin/curl -s “http://127.0.0.1/status?xml&#8221; | grep “” | awk -F’>|<' '{ print $$3}'

killall zabbix_agentd

/usr/local/zabbix/sbin/zabbix_agentd

最后在zabbix-server 导入模板连接模板即可

模板下载地址

zabbix监控php-fpm模板-zabbix 3.x

zabbix监控php-fpm模板-zabbix 2.x


搞代码网(gaodaima.com)提供的所有资源部分来自互联网,如果有侵犯您的版权或其他权益,请说明详细缘由并提供版权或权益证明然后发送到邮箱[email protected],我们会在看到邮件的第一时间内为您处理,或直接联系QQ:872152909。本网站采用BY-NC-SA协议进行授权
转载请注明原文链接:zabbix 监控php-fpm 性能

喜欢 (0)
[搞代码]
分享 (0)
发表我的评论
取消评论

表情 贴图 加粗 删除线 居中 斜体 签到

Hi,您需要填写昵称和邮箱!

  • 昵称 (必填)
  • 邮箱 (必填)
  • 网址